Subject: Config hot-reload enabled for Perchstone services

Team,

As of this week's cut, Perchstone gateway and worker tiers reload configuration without restarts. Changes pushed through the Faldrin config store take effect within thirty seconds; no drain or redeploy required. Rollback is the same path in reverse. Note that TLS material and port bindings are excluded and still need a restart. Marnie Oakhurst will demo the flow at the sync. If you see stale values, pull the reload trace and compare it against the token below.

session token of fahaf-kajog = htk4_37a3

New Starter Day One — Checklist Item 7: Badge Migration (Ostrelle Systems)

Note that Ostrelle is mid-migration from the old Keyfane swipe cards to the new Dorrity tap badges. New starters will receive a Dorrity badge at the front desk, but it will not work on legacy doors (east stairwell, print room, loading bay) until the cutover completes next month. For those doors, assistants should accompany the starter and use the shared interim keypad entry. For reference, the interim code is as follows.

staff pass of kawip-hawef = bdg-QLP-2

## Service Accounts: Ledgerbeam Billing Worker

Blue-green deploys for the Ledgerbeam billing worker require both color slots to authenticate against the internal metering service during cutover. Reviewers should confirm that the green slot's service account has identical scopes to blue before approving, since a scope mismatch caused the March rollback. The credential used by both slots is listed below for verification.

service key, fawip-bajef: kto11_Qt5wZK9vdNC

Step 4: Pin the Lanternkit component library to the 5.x line before upgrading consumers. Mixed major versions will break theming tokens silently, so verify every package in the Bramblewood monorepo resolves to the same release. Once pinned, update the resolver settings to match the values shown immediately below this paragraph.

deployment values, yadug-bawif:
[framir]
team = pelox
access_code = ac_a38ab2
owner = tamion.julael
host = framir.tolvaqlabs.test
port = 11211
peer = tammir.zemvargrid.local
salt = 2215ef03
pin = 1541